My Secret Sky is a quiet yet poignant drama that captures the struggles of two young siblings navigating the stark contrasts of rural life and urban existence. Set against the backdrop of Durban, the film unfolds with a certain rawness, emphasizing the innocence of childhood amidst harsh realities. The pacing is deliberately slow, which allows for moments of reflection and emotional depth. The performances, particularly from the young leads, feel genuine and heartfelt, pulling you into their world of hope and despair. The atmosphere is enriched by practical effects that ground their journey in a tangible way. It’s distinctive in its exploration of faith and resilience, making it a nuanced look at survival in an unforgiving environment.
